Employee Information

Basic details such as name, job title (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or), department, review period, and reviewer’s name. This sets the context and ensures accurate documentation.

Performance Summary

In the Performance Summary section for a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or, the review should encapsulate the counselor’s effectiveness in client engagement, therapeutic outcomes, and adherence to ethical standards. It should highlight their ability to build rapport with clients, employ evidence-based practices, and contribute to the mental well-being of their clients. The summary should also reflect on the counselor’s collaboration with colleagues, participation in professional development, and adaptability to new counseling techniques or technologies. Additionally, it should acknowledge any significant achievements, such as successful case resolutions or contributions to team initiatives, while also identifying areas for growth. Overall, the summary should provide a balanced view of the counselor’s impact on both their clients and the organization, emphasizing their role in fostering a supportive and effective therapeutic environment.

Key Performance Areas (KPAs)

In a performance review for a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or, the Key Performance Areas should encompass several critical aspects. Technical Skills should evaluate the counselor’s proficiency in therapeutic techniques and their ability to apply evidence-based practices effectively. Productivity and Efficiency should assess their caseload management, timely documentation, and ability to meet client needs promptly. Collaboration and Communication should focus on their interactions with clients, colleagues, and other healthcare professionals, emphasizing active listening and empathy. Quality of Work should examine the counselor’s success in achieving client outcomes, maintaining ethical standards, and continuously improving their practice through professional development. These KPAs provide a comprehensive evaluation of the counselor’s competencies, aligning with their role and responsibilities in the counseling industry.

Goal Achievement

In the Goal Achievement section of a performance review for a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or, it is important to assess the progress made toward previously established goals, such as client outcomes, caseload management, and professional development. This evaluation should consider the counselor’s effectiveness in implementing therapeutic interventions, maintaining client engagement, and achieving treatment objectives. Additionally, it should reflect on the counselor’s ability to meet administrative responsibilities, such as timely documentation and compliance with ethical standards. The review should highlight areas where the counselor excels, such as innovative approaches or strong client rapport, while also identifying areas needing improvement or additional support, such as specific therapeutic skills or workload management. This comprehensive assessment helps ensure the counselor’s continued growth and effectiveness in providing high-quality mental health care.

Areas for Improvement

In the Areas for Improvement section of a performance review for a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or, it is important to provide constructive feedback that encourages growth while maintaining a supportive tone. Focus on specific skills or behaviors that could benefit from further development, such as enhancing active listening techniques or expanding knowledge of emerging therapeutic modalities. For instance, you might suggest attending workshops to improve cultural competency or exploring new strategies for managing client resistance. Highlight the importance of self-care to prevent burnout, emphasizing the counselor’s well-being as crucial to their effectiveness. By offering actionable insights, such as setting goals for supervision or peer collaboration, you can foster a path for professional development that aligns with both the counselor’s aspirations and the organization’s objectives.

Development Plan and Goals for the Next Period

In the Development Plan and Goals for the Next Period section of a performance review for a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or, it is essential to outline goals that enhance both professional growth and alignment with organizational objectives. This may include pursuing advanced certifications or specialized training to deepen expertise in specific therapeutic modalities, thereby improving client outcomes. Engaging in mentorship opportunities can also be beneficial for skill enhancement and professional networking. Additionally, setting SMART goals such as increasing client retention rates by a certain percentage within a specified timeframe or implementing a new evidence-based practice in therapy sessions can drive measurable performance improvements. These goals should be tailored to the counselor’s career aspirations and the organization’s strategic priorities, ensuring they are both challenging and attainable.

Rating Scale

A rating scale (e.g., 1-5 or “Needs Improvement” to “Exceeds Expectations”) standardizes feedback and makes performance levels more understandable.

Employee Comments

A space for your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or employee to share their thoughts, feedback, or concerns about their review. This encourages dialogue and helps employees feel engaged in the process.

Signatures and Date

Signatures from both the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or employee and reviewer indicate that the review was discussed and agreed upon, making it official and fostering accountability.
